Radioactive nuclei that are injected into a patient collect at certain sites within its body, undergoing radioactive decay and emitting electromagnetic radiation. These radiations can then be recorded by a detector. This procedure provides an important diagnostic tool called
A. Gamma ray
B. CAT scan
C. Radiotracer technique
D. Gamma ray spectroscopy
Answer
266.1k+ views
Hint: A radioactive nuclei injected into a patient gets collected at some sites within the body where radioactive decay undergoes. And it emits electromagnetic radiation. This radiation can be recorded by an detector.
Complete answer:
In this process a radioactive nuclei is injected into a patient to collect some places into a body of the patient where radioactive disintegration takes place and it emits an electromagnetic radiation. This radiation can be recorded by a detector. That detector name is called radiotracers. And this type of process is known as radiotracer technique.
This technique is a common application of radioisotopes. It is a radioactive element whose path is through which a chemical reaction can be followed. These types of tracers are commonly used in the medical field and in the study of plants and animals.
Radioactive Iodine-131 can be used to study the process of the thyroid gland assisting in detecting diseases. Application of radiotracers is a radioactive element: equipment that gives the pathway through a chemical reaction can be followed by the help of tracers. We can follow the path of chemical reactions that tracers are commonly used in the medical field.
Hence, the correct answer is option C
Note: The emission of radiation by radiotracers is commonly easy to detect and measure with high precision. The emission of radiation is independent of pressure, temperature, chemical state and physical state. And this type of radiotracers are not affected by the system and can be mainly used in nondestructive techniques.
